Wallace 和 Radix-4 Booth-Wallace乘法器性能分析
对于Booth乘法器和Wallace乘法器对比
这篇文章提到:
综合结果表明,与radix-4 Booth-Wallace乘法器相比,Wallace乘法器的延迟降低了17%,功耗降低了70%。 华莱士乘法器的功率延迟乘积(PDP)比布斯-华莱士乘法器低68%。
图1 Wallace Tree Mult
- 注:每个小方框是一个全加器FA,最后stage是半加器HA
如图很明显,Wallace Tree乘法器主要是通过加法器(压缩器)完成部分积的累加,但可以看出Wallace得到的部分积很多,几乎与位宽数一直,所以必定需要很多的加法器,一连串的加法在增加面积的同时也会增加时延。
图2 Radix-4 Booth乘法器
通过本人对Booth乘法器的综合分析,对比其他乘法器,Booth无疑是面积和功耗开销最小的乘法器之一(不敢说的绝对)。这篇文章只分析了Wallace和Booth在逻辑综合后电路的延迟和功耗的对比,并没有提及面积开销对比,说明他知道Booth的面积开销明显是小的。这么重要的分析因子居然没提,只是为了体现论文的说服力吧,毕竟学术和产品是有很大差距的。
至于各个延时大小,本人没有验证,不过从结构来分析并不像论文中说的那个样子……
【这篇文提到Booth乘法器综合】
Wallace 和 Radix-4 Booth-Wallace乘法器性能分析相关推荐
- dpsk调制解调 matlab,2DPSK调制与解调系统的MATLAB实现及性能分析.doc
2DPSK调制与解调系统的MATLAB实现及性能分析 2DPSK调制与解调系统的MATLAB实现及性能分析 摘 要:MATLAB集成环境下的Simulink仿真平台,设计一个2DPSK调制与解调系统. ...
- Go 学习笔记(81)— Go 性能分析工具 pprof
Go 语言工具链中的 go pprof 可以帮助开发者快速分析及定位各种性能问题,如 CPU消耗 .内存分配及阻塞分析 .具体作用如下: 性能分析首先需要使用 runtime.pprof 包嵌入到待分 ...
- App性能分析数据监控
App性能分析数据监控 APP的性能监控包括: CPU 占用率.内存使用情况.网络状况监控.启动时闪退.卡顿.FPS.使用时崩溃.耗电量监控.流量监控等等. 文中所有代码都已同步到github中,有兴 ...
- Tesla T4视频编码性能分析
Tesla T4视频编码性能分析 从开普勒开始的所有 NVIDIA GPUs 都支持完全加速的硬件视频编码: GPUs 支持完全加速的硬件视频解码.最近发布的图灵硬件提供了张量核心和更好的机器学习性能 ...
- Yolov4性能分析(下)
Yolov4性能分析(下) 六. 权重更新 "darknet/src/detector.c"–train_detector()函数中: ....../* 开始训练网络 */floa ...
- Yolov4性能分析(上)
Yolov4性能分析(上) 一.目录 实验测试 1) 测试介绍 2) Test 3) Train 二.分析 1.实验测试 1 实验测试方法 Yolov4训练train实验方法(Darknet shou ...
- 关于 Rocksdb 性能分析 需要知道的一些“小技巧“ -- perf_context的“内功” ,systemtap、perf、 ftrace的颜值
文章目录 内部工具 包含头文件 接口使用 核心指标 Perf Context IOStats Context 外部工具 Systemtap 工具 Perf工具 Ftrace 工具 2020.8.20 ...
- Linux性能分析命令工具汇总
转自:http://rdc.hundsun.com/portal/article/731.html?ref=myread 出于对Linux操作系统的兴趣,以及对底层知识的强烈欲望,因此整理了这篇文章. ...
- C#中判断空字符串的3种方法性能分析【月儿原创】
C#中判断空字符串的3种方法性能分析 作者:清清月儿 主页:http://blog.csdn.net/21aspnet/ 时间:2007.4.28 3种方法分别是:string ...
最新文章
- R语言使用ggplot2可视化互相覆盖的直方图实战(Overlaying histograms)
- 【转】c++重载、覆盖、隐藏——理不清的区别
- DNN 4.6.2的中文语言包
- Spring和MyBatis的整合
- 简单Hook SYSENTER
- java List实体排序
- python以垂直方式输出hello world_python3提问:垂直输出Hello World,全部代码不超过2行....
- Magento: 获取产品评论 get all reviews with review summary
- 小目标Trick | Detectron2、MMDetection、YOLOv5都通用的小目标检测解决方案
- 传统CPU架构不再是高性能计算唯一选择
- java后台restTemplate生成二小程序维码,前端渲染
- SVN检出项目到本地
- 重庆邮电大学c语言题库
- 如何设计一个秒杀系统(完整版)
- SQL解密ctext字段内容函数
- STM32 HAL库学习笔记3-HAL库外设驱动框架概述
- 用sympy库解常微分方程
- python123第三单元测试卷_第三单元测试卷(带答案)
- IDEA中运行maven多模块项目,提示程序包xxxx不存在
- 51单片机的仿真实验——1602显示屏显示万年历与温度
热门文章
- [思维模式-12]:《如何系统思考》-8- 工具篇 - 因果回路图/系统循环图/系统控制图,系统思考的关键工具
- 前端笔记 (持续更新~)
- 红石模拟器android,Win10 Mobile红石3支持x86模拟器
- jotform 设计器_如何使用JotForm简化表单构建
- tpch测试mysql_数据库系统TPC-H测试方法及结果分析
- 电脑关闭休眠模式清理 C盘内存
- LUN、ThickLUN与Thin LUN的联系和区别
- android 生成 QR_CODE 码 PFD_417码 CODE_36码
- Sqlserver官网下载时各版本含义
- loadrunner是什么